Jersey Shore star Jenni Farley, better known to fans as JWoww, turned her back on our rival Atlantic City and picked her first-ever visit to Las Vegas to celebrate her birthday. JWoww turned up for a weekend of fun at the Palms and on her first night started out with dinner at Little Buddha. Then JWoww had a VIP stage table at Rain for DJ Z-Trip’s weekly performance, where she and 10 friends danced to the beats and partied hearty.

I can tell you that unlike Mike “The Situation” Sorrentino, who is single and playing the field, JWoww has a steady boyfriend in her life. His name is Tom Lippolis, and he was right beside her for the 25th birthday dinner at Nove Italiano in the Palms. It was the second visit in the same day for Jenni and Tommy because earlier, they’d attended executive chef Geno Bernardo’s cooking class.

The group took a table right in the center of the main dining room and ordered a family-style menu of pizzas, calamari and panzanella salads for starters and chicken Parmigiano, spaghetti Bolognese and pennette alla vodka for the main course. Then it was time for the first birthday cake of the night that Geno brought out to the table. That prompted everybody in the restaurant to sing “Happy Birthday.”

After dinner, JWoww and her dad hit The Playboy Club and were presented with a Playboy key. After that presentation, JWoww and her friends headed to Moon, where the Playboy Bunnies presented her with another birthday cake.

JWoww wanted the night to never end, so they then went off to Rain and were seen in the pre-dawn hours partying on the main stage and dancing while fist pumping to the beats of Junkie XL. VDLX reader and videographer Richard Corey uploaded his videos to YouTube.

NICK CANNON @VANITY

Actor, rapper and TV personality Nick Cannon hosted the evening at Vanity in the HRH Tower at the Hard Rock Hotel. Nick arrived without wife Mariah Carey, who had host duties at Haze in CityCenter’s Aria after her Caesars Palace show Saturday night. Nick was dressed in a black fedora, undone bowtie and suspenders and was joined on the red carpet by hip-hop group RydazNrtisT, who were the opening act for Mariah’s The Angels Advocate Tour that concluded at The Colosseum.

Although it was 12:30 a.m. yesterday, Nick gave DJ Clinton Sparks a break from the turntables and took over the DJ booth for an hour. They took turns hyping up the crowd. As a RydazNrtisT member pulled out a camera, Nick announced that they were filming a music video and if anyone wanted to be in it, “to get closer and shake their sexy bodies.” The hip-hop group then jumped onstage and, along with Nick, performed two of their hit songs. Nick then settled in to enjoy DJ Sparks’ set before he called it a night to join Mariah, who had partied at Haze with singer Ciara.
